EUR/USD Price Forecast: Upbeat US Dollar stresses on major currency pair

During the European trading session on Tuesday, the Euro (EUR) experienced a slight decline, trading near 1.1593 against the US Dollar (USD). This was influenced by the US Dollar's outperformance, driven by expectations of the Federal Reserve (Fed) raising interest rates soon. The US Dollar Index (DXY), which measures the Greenback's value against six major currencies, rose by 0.2% to approximately 99.60.

Analysts at Rabobank noted that Fed Chair Kevin Warsh's recent address to the Jackson Hole Symposium showcased a more inflation-fighting stance, suggesting a potential shift in the Fed's communication strategy. This development could benefit the US Dollar and pressure the Euro's value. Additionally, investors are keeping an eye on the upcoming US ISM Manufacturing PMI data for August and the US JOLTS Job Openings data for July.

In the Eurozone, the preliminary Harmonized Index of Consumer Prices (HICP) for August increased to 3.3% year-on-year, surpassing the expected 2.9% and indicating stronger inflation.
